π Bacon Wrapped Cream Cheese Stuffed Chicken Breast
This **Bacon Wrapped Cream Cheese Stuffed Chicken Breast** is juicy, cheesy, and wrapped in crispy bacon β a restaurant-quality dinner that's easy to make at home. Perfect for weeknights or impressing guests!
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 4 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- 1/2 tsp onion powder
- 1/2 tsp paprika
- Salt and black pepper to taste
- 8 slices bacon (1β2 per breast)
- 1 tbsp olive oil (optional, for searing)
- 1/4 cup ranch or blue cheese dressing (for serving, optional)
Instructions
- Butterfly chicken: Slice each chicken breast horizontally through the side, stopping before cutting all the way through. Open like a book.
- Make filling: In a bowl, mix cream cheese, cheddar, Parmesan,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
- Stuff chicken: Spread 1β2 tbsp of filling inside each breast. Fold closed and secure with toothpicks.
- Wrap with bacon: Wrap each breast with 1β2 slices of bacon, tucking ends underneath.
- Cook (Oven Method): Preheat oven to 375Β°F (190Β°C). Place chicken on a baking sheet (or over a wire rack). Bake 22β28 minutes until chicken reaches 165Β°F and bacon is crispy.
- Cook (Stove + Oven Method - Optional): Sear bacon-wrapped chicken in a hot skillet with oil for 2β3 minutes per side, then transfer to oven to finish baking.
- Rest 5 minutes, remove toothpicks, then slice and serve.
- Serve with ranch or blue cheese dressing for dipping!
Tip: Add chopped spinach, sun-dried tomatoes, or jalapeΓ±os to the filling for extra flavor!
